Transaction cfa829be610719155528ecb223eabc436979d2b57220150389b35cf594d63c14
1 Input
1 Output
-
cfa829be610719155528ecb223eabc436979d2b57220150389b35cf594d63c14:0
- value
- 149407612
- script pubkey
- OP_0 OP_PUSHBYTES_20 57ade6e521755fad9f6aecb129a41e7177f4cee1
- address
- bc1q27k7defpw406m8m2ajcjnfq7w9mlfnhpj9uqrt